Transaction 2efb3cfe664d9581fa93c501eaa087396826cf1e656a16f932f4dc7efd8dfeca

1 Input
2 Outputs
  • 2efb3cfe664d9581fa93c501eaa087396826cf1e656a16f932f4dc7efd8dfeca:0
  • value  17364837214
    address  17H3XSCwusS586pGhN8c4r6UCeRZejyohj
  • 2efb3cfe664d9581fa93c501eaa087396826cf1e656a16f932f4dc7efd8dfeca:1
  • value  54476100
    address  1KEcgzRyDRjUrYxtuKjfHRSo7tR2xLa3sb